The Level 6 and Level 7 Diplomas in Health and Social Care Management are postgraduate qualifications that offer advanced knowledge and skills in healthcare management, social care, and related fields.
Learning outcomes for these diplomas include developing strategic leadership and management skills, understanding healthcare policy and legislation, and applying research methods to improve practice.
The duration of the Level 6 Diploma is typically 12-18 months, while the Level 7 Diploma takes around 18-24 months to complete, depending on the institution and the student's prior experience.
These diplomas are highly relevant to the healthcare and social care industries, as they equip students with the knowledge and skills required to manage and lead healthcare services, develop policies and procedures, and evaluate the effectiveness of care.
